question 19 (5 points)
simplify \\(-\sqrt{-48}\\).
a) \\(-4\sqrt{3}\\)
b) \\(4\sqrt{3}i\\)
c) \\(4\sqrt{3}\\)
d) \\(-4\sqrt{3}i\\)

Simplify the radical expression
$$
-\sqrt{-48} = -\sqrt{48 \cdot (-1)} = -\sqrt{16 \cdot 3} \cdot i = -4\sqrt{3}i
$$
